The Constant Mass Density Blocks Set from Micro Technologies is a practical laboratory specimen collection developed to help students investigate the relationship between mass, density, volume and material type.
The set consists of nine different material blocks, each designed to have approximately the same mass of 20 g. Because the mass remains approximately constant while the material changes, the physical size and volume of each specimen vary according to its density.
The nine included materials are pine, maple, PVC, nylon, acrylic, aluminium, copper, brass and steel. This combination provides examples of woods, polymers and metals within a single experimental set.
The fundamental relationship demonstrated by the apparatus is:
Density = Mass ÷ Volume
When mass is held constant, the relationship can also be considered as:
Volume = Mass ÷ Density
Therefore, materials with a higher density require a smaller volume to achieve the same approximate mass, while materials with a lower density require a larger volume.
The wooden specimens, pine and maple, provide useful examples of relatively low-density natural materials. Their physical dimensions can be compared with denser polymer and metallic specimens.
The set includes three polymer specimens—PVC, nylon and acrylic—allowing students to compare synthetic materials with both natural woods and metals.
Four metallic specimens—aluminium, copper, brass and steel—provide a broad comparison of commonly studied engineering metals.
The differences in specimen size make the density relationship visually apparent even before quantitative measurements are performed.
Students can measure the length, width and height of individual blocks using a suitable ruler or Vernier Caliper. These measurements can then be used to calculate specimen volume.
A laboratory balance may also be used to verify that each specimen has an approximate mass of 20 g.
Using experimentally determined mass and volume, students can calculate the density of each material and compare their results with appropriate reference values.
The set is particularly useful for explaining why two objects can have the same mass but significantly different physical dimensions.
It can also support material-identification exercises. Students may calculate the density of a coded or unknown specimen and compare the result with reference density values to determine its likely material.
When used alongside a Constant Volume Density Blocks Set, students can investigate two complementary concepts: equal-volume specimens exhibit different masses, while equal-mass specimens exhibit different volumes.
This comparison provides a more complete understanding of the relationship between mass, volume and density.
